The neighborhood known as Southeast Memphis covers a huge section of the city, offering a large selection of apartment and rental options within minutes of Memphis’ most popular attractions and amenities. Downtown is only a few blocks away from the north end of the neighborhood, allowing residents to hop in anytime and take full advantage of the legendary dining, entertainment, and nightlife along Beale Street, catch a ball game at AutoZone Park, or explore the countless museums and galleries.
While most of Southeast Memphis is residential, it offers convenient access to some of the city’s biggest workplaces: the Medical District sits just outside the northern end of the neighborhood, Memphis Depot Industrial park sits near the center, and Memphis International Airport occupies the south side. The local rental market is extremely diverse throughout the neighborhood, with a huge selection of budget-friendly apartments and condos as well as swanky condos and single-family homes.
